SPD (Spreadtrum) is a popular Chinese mobile chip manufacturer that produces a wide range of mobile chipsets used in various Android devices. However, due to various reasons such as software issues, hardware damage, or improper flashing of firmware, the IMEI (International Mobile Equipment Identity) number of an SPD-based Android device may get lost or corrupted. This can lead to issues with network connectivity, device tracking, and even warranty claims.
